码迷,mamicode.com
首页 >  
搜索关键字:软件危机    ( 120个结果
OO9-11总结
规格化设计的大致发展历史 1960年代末—1970年代初,出现软件危机:对软件系统的大量需求与软件的研制周期长,可靠性差,维护困难的现实情况形成矛盾。于是人们希望编写出的程序结构清晰、易阅读、易修改、易验证,即得到好结构的程序。1968年,北大西洋公约组织召开第一次软件工程会议,分析了危机的局面,研 ...
分类:其他好文   时间:2018-05-30 00:27:21    阅读次数:159
oo第三次总结
调研 软件形式化方法最早可追溯到20世纪50年代后期对于程序设计语言编译技术的研究,即J.Backus提出BNF描述Algol60语言的语法,出现了各 种语法分析程序自动生成器以及语法制导的编译方法,使得编译系统的开发从“手工艺制作方式”发展成具有牢固理论基础的系统方法。 形式化方法的研究高潮始于2 ...
分类:其他好文   时间:2018-05-29 13:15:42    阅读次数:153
软件工程学习笔记(考试版)
第一章 软件工程学简述 Q:软件的定义 A:软件是计算机系统中与硬件相互依存的另一部分,它是包括程序、数据及其相关文档的完整集合。 程序,按事先设计的功能和性能要求执行的指令序列 数据,使程序能正常操纵信息的数据结构 文档,与程序开发,维护和使用有关的图文材料 Q:软件危机的定义 A: 软件危机是指 ...
分类:其他好文   时间:2018-05-11 23:51:04    阅读次数:375
阅读《软件工程基础》所产生的问题。
1、关于软件危机,从书中可以看出,现如今人们对这个问题已经有了相当的了解,包括它所产生的的原因以及解决方法。既然解决方法都有,但为何仍然要强调这个问题呢? 2、世界上有相当多的编程语言,各自都有自己独特的功能。但一个人的精力毕竟是有限的,是无法彻底掌握每一种语言的。那为什么不集这些语言的优点于一身, ...
分类:其他好文   时间:2018-03-20 00:40:18    阅读次数:194
UML统一建模语言
什么是UML? UML全称是: Unified Modeling Language 又称统一建模语言或标准建模语言。 是一个支持模型化和软件系统开发的图形化语言,为软件开发的所有阶段提供模型化和可视化支持,包括由需求分析到规格,到构造和配置。 它是一种语言,语言就是用来描述一件事物的。 为什么我们要 ...
分类:编程语言   时间:2018-03-07 20:14:37    阅读次数:167
软件工程基础之二——阅读《软件工程基础》的问题
1、软件危机中软件的后期维护问题——第一章 现在虽然做过一些小项目,但在编码之后最多也只是加了一个“测试”阶段,对于后期维护从没有涉及过。假期听见我哥和我爸就程序员和甲方的立场对于后期维护提出了截然不同的观念,程序员吐槽后期维护太繁琐艰巨甚至奇葩,而甲方则认为理所应当。还有时限方面,一个项目的后期维 ...
分类:其他好文   时间:2018-03-05 23:31:36    阅读次数:178
人月神话阅读笔记01
正如《人月神话》简介所述,在软件领域,很少能有像《人月神话》一样具有深远影响力和畅销不衰的著作。 它为人们管理复杂项目提供了最具有洞察力的见解,既为很多发人深省的观点,又有大量软件工程的实践。 拉布雷阿的焦油坑,让人印象深刻,与软件开发泥潭如此相似,越挣扎陷的越深,软件危机席卷IT行业: 费用超支、 ...
分类:其他好文   时间:2018-02-14 21:06:56    阅读次数:179
1.1软件工程概述之软件危机
典型表现1.对软件开发成本和进度的估计不够准确。2.用户对“已完成的”软件系统不满意的现象经常出现。3.软件产品的质量往往靠不住。4.软件常常是不可维护的。(不可重用)5.软件没有适当的文档说明。6.软件成本在计算机系统总成本中占比越来越高。7.软件开发生产率提升的速度远远跟不上计算机应用迅速普及和 ...
分类:其他好文   时间:2018-02-12 13:37:01    阅读次数:152
软件开发方法
在上个世纪60年代中期爆发了众所周知的软件危机。为了克服这一危机,在1968、1969年连续召开的两次著名的NATO会议上提出了软件工程这一术语,并在以后不断发展、完善。与此同时,软件研究人员也在不断探索新的软件开发方法。至今已形成了八类软件开发方法。中文名 软件开发方法 提出时间 1972年 原则 ...
分类:其他好文   时间:2018-01-16 11:12:41    阅读次数:189
课后作业-阅读任务-阅读笔记-0
软件工程的目标 提供软件的质量与生产率,最终实现软件的工业化生产,好的软件工程方法可以同时提高质量与生产率。 软件危机:在计算机软件的开发和维护过程中所遇到的一系列严重问题。 软件危机的原因:技术原因,软件规模越来越大,软件复杂度越来越高 ...
分类:其他好文   时间:2017-12-06 20:16:02    阅读次数:166
120条   上一页 1 2 3 4 5 6 ... 12 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!